Product Overview

Category

AD7547JNZ belongs to the category of digital-to-analog converters (DACs).

Use

It is primarily used to convert digital signals into analog signals.

Characteristics

  • High precision and accuracy
  • Fast conversion speed
  • Low power consumption
  • Wide operating temperature range

Package

AD7547JNZ comes in a 20-pin plastic DIP (Dual Inline Package) package.

Essence

The essence of AD7547JNZ lies in its ability to accurately convert digital data into corresponding analog voltages.

Packaging/Quantity

The product is typically packaged in reels or tubes, with a quantity of 25 units per package.

Specifications

  • Resolution: 12 bits
  • Supply Voltage: +5V
  •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to +85°C
  • Conversion Time: 10µs
  • Output Voltage Range: 0V to Vref

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ages

  • High precision and accuracy in converting digital signals to analog voltages
  • Wide operating temperature range allows for use in various environments
  • Low power consumption ensures energy efficiency

Disadvantages

  • Limited output voltage range may not be suitable for certain applications requiring higher voltages
  • Requires external reference voltage for proper operation

Working Principles

AD7547JNZ operates on the principle of binary-weighted resistor networks. It uses a combination of resistors to convert the digital input into an analog output voltage. The digital data is decoded and applied to the appropriate resistor network, which generates the corresponding analog voltage.

Detailed Application Field Plans

AD7547JNZ finds applications in various fields, including:

  1. Industrial Automation: Used in control systems to convert digital control signals into analog signals for actuators and sensors.
  2. Audio Equipment: Utilized in audio devices to convert digital audio signals into analog signals for amplification and playback.
  3. Instrumentation: Employed in measurement instruments to generate precise analog voltages for calibration and testing purposes.
  4. Communication Systems: Integrated into communication systems to convert digital signals into analog signals for transmission and reception.
